YunoHost 11.0 (Bullseye) release / Sortie de YunoHost 11.0 (Bullseye)

dpkg --get-selections|grep 'linux-image*'|awk '{print $1}'|egrep -v "linux-image-$(uname -r)|linux-image-generic" |while read n;do apt-get -y remove $n;done

Maintenant c’est postgreSQL qui bloque

La migration 0023_postgresql_11_to_13 a échoué avec l'exception PostgreSQL 11 est installé, mais pas PostgreSQL 13 ! ? Quelque chose d'anormal s'est peut-être produit sur votre système :(... : annulation

@Nico1 : est-ce que tu peux partager le retour de dpkg --list | grep postgresql ?

ii  postgresql-11                         11.17-0+deb10u1                                  amd64        object-relational SQL database, version 11 server
ii  postgresql-client-11                  11.17-0+deb10u1                                  amd64        front-end programs for PostgreSQL 11
ii  postgresql-client-common              225                                              all          manager for multiple PostgreSQL client versions
ii  postgresql-common                     225                                              all          PostgreSQL database-cluster manager
Aaaand let’s also look at

grep -B10 'Depends:.*postgresql' /var/lib/dpkg/status | grep 'ynh\|Depends'

Congratulations

grep -B10 'Depends:.*postgresql' /var/lib/dpkg/status | grep 'ynh\|Depends'
Depends: locales | locales-all, postgresql-client-11, postgresql-common (>= 194~), ssl-cert, tzdata, debconf (>= 0.5) | debconf-2.0, libc6 (>= 2.17), libgcc1 (>= 1:3.0), libgssapi-krb5-2 (>= 1.14+dfsg), libicu63 (>= 63.1-1~), libldap-2.4-2 (>= 2.4.7), libllvm7 (>= 1:7~svn298832-1~), libpam0g (>=, libpq5 (>= 9.3~), libselinux1 (>= 2.1.12), libssl1.1 (>= 1.1.0), libstdc++6 (>= 5.2), libsystemd0, libuuid1 (>= 2.16), libxml2 (>= 2.7.4), libxslt1.1 (>= 1.1.25), zlib1g (>= 1:1.1.4)
Depends: libpq5 (>= 11.17), postgresql-client-common (>= 182~), sensible-utils, libc6 (>= 2.15), libedit2 (>= 3.1-20180525-0), zlib1g (>= 1:1.1.4)
Depends: adduser, debconf (>= 0.5.00) | debconf-2.0, lsb-base (>= 3.0-3), perl (>= 5.14), postgresql-client-common (= 225), ssl-cert (>= 1.0.11), ucf

UUuuuh wokay that’s not what I expected :thinking:

Could it be that this bug arises when an app requiring postgresql was installed, but is the app was removed and postgresql is still there for some reason ?

What happens if you run apt remove postgresql-11 --dry-run ? (this won’t remove anything, just simulate what it would do)

apt remove postgresql-11 --dry-run
Lecture des listes de paquets... Fait
Construction de l'arbre des dépendances... Fait
Lecture des informations d'état... Fait
Les paquets suivants ont été installés automatiquement et ne sont plus nécessaires :
  bind9-utils bind9utils dnsutils libicu63 libllvm7
  libsensors-config libsensors5 php-gettext php7.3-gd
  php7.3-intl php7.3-ldap postgresql-common python3-ply
  python3-publicsuffix sysstat
Veuillez utiliser « apt autoremove » pour les supprimer.
Les paquets suivants seront ENLEVÉS :
0 mis à jour, 0 nouvellement installés, 1 à enlever et 0 non mis à jour.
Remv postgresql-11 [11.17-0+deb10u1]

Hmouai ça a l’air d’être ça, il faut désinstaller postgresql-11, et si la migration postgresql est toujours là, la skip

Best announcement ever ! :partying_face: :star_struck:

Encore une fois

Magicien :kissing_heart::kissing_heart::kissing_heart::kissing_heart:

Tout est ok .

Hello : une petite boulette dans le texte pour l’étape 24 de la mise à jour :
yunohost app upgrade -F APP et non yunohost app upgrade -f APP

Et bien…

Depuis le serveur a été redémarré, et en fait n’a jamais fini de s’éteindre à cause de postgresql (que j’ai dû tuer pour arriver à finir le redémarrage).
Et… il ne démarre plus correctement. Je n’ai plus d’accès SSH &co.

J’ai peut-être le même problème que @Nico1 :thinking: ping @Aleks.

Et probablement pas d’autre solution que de restaurer une sauvegarde :thinking:

ping @ljf (cf YunoHost 11.0 (Bullseye) release / Sortie de YunoHost 11.0 (Bullseye) - #43 by ljf)

I already made a fix for the one @Krakinou found: [fix] -f and --force are not thje same with yunohos app upgrade · YunoHost/yunohost@5d90971 · GitHub

It will be in next fix release


ran the migration from the CLI.

worked perfectly! thank you to the devs and good luck to those trying to get sorted.

hugs to aleks right now with tech support.

3 Likes , but can you ping google with ssh ?

Sometime when i can’t do apt update etc and i’ve got this result. So it because server can’t reach website because DNS or not good or a problem with it.

with ssh, can you ping :

Sur ma briq lime 1, j’ai tenté la migration vers Bullseye.

Je suis maintenant sous Debian 11

# lsb_release -a
No LSB modules are available.
Distributor ID:	Debian
Description:	Debian GNU/Linux 11 (bullseye)
Release:	11
Codename:	bullseye

avec un noyau 4.19.62-sunxi

Dans le web, j’avais accès aux application mais pas à l’administration : Error 500.
Entre temps, j’ai redémarré la briq. Je n’ai plus accès par le web, le hotspot n’est pas visible.
Pourtant les services sont “running” mais avec des erreurs.

Il y a surtout OSError: [Errno 28] No space left on device

En effet,

# df -h
Filesystem      Size  Used Avail Use% Mounted on
udev            179M     0  179M   0% /dev
tmpfs            50M  6.8M   43M  14% /run
/dev/mmcblk0p1   29G  4.1G   24G  15% /
tmpfs           247M   24K  247M   1% /dev/shm
tmpfs           5.0M     0  5.0M   0% /run/lock
tmpfs           247M     0  247M   0% /tmp
/dev/sda4       367G  241G  108G  70% /home
/dev/sda3        49G  6.5G   40G  14% /var
/dev/zram0       49M   48M     0 100% /var/log
tmpfs            50M     0   50M   0% /run/user/1000

/var/log est à ras bord !
J’ai apt clean et apt-get autoremove je ne sais pas quoi déplacer de /var/log pour faire de la place pastebin - outil de debug collaboratif

Sinon # journalctl -xe me donne 1000 lignes du genre rsyslogd[696]: file '/var/log/syslog'[8] write error - see>

À la commande # dpkg --configure -a j’obtiens

php7.0-fpm.service - The PHP 7.0 FastCGI Process Manager
     Loaded: loaded (/lib/systemd/system/php7.0-fpm.service; disabled; vendor preset: enabled)
     Active: failed (Result: exit-code) since Sat 2022-08-13 10:09:52 UTC; 132ms ago
       Docs: man:php-fpm7.0(8)
    Process: 5503 ExecStart=/usr/sbin/php-fpm7.0 --nodaemonize --fpm-config /etc/php/7.0/fpm/php-fpm.conf (code=exited, status=78)
    Process: 5504 ExecStopPost=/usr/lib/php/php-fpm-socket-helper remove /run/php/php-fpm.sock /etc/php/7.0/fpm/pool.d/www.conf 70 (code=exited, status=0/SUCCESS)
   Main PID: 5503 (code=exited, status=78)
        CPU: 624ms

Je lance # systemctl status php7.0-fpm.service
On peut voir php-fpm7.0[5503]: [13-Aug-2022 10:09:52] WARNING: [pool garradin] 'request_slowlog_timeout' i>
Je tente le nettoyage de noyaux dpkg --get-selections|grep 'linux-image*'|awk '{print $1}'|egrep -v "linux-image-$(uname -r)|linux-image-generic" |while read n;do apt-get -y remove $n;done qui devrait libérer 70,3MB en retirant le noyau linux-image-next-sunxi (5.92) mais j’ai des dpkg: cannot write to log file '/var/log/dpkg.log': No space left on device et

Errors were encountered while processing:
E: Write error - ~LZMAFILE (28: No space left on device)
E: Sub-process /usr/bin/dpkg returned an error code (1)

et je n’en sors pas.
Quelle serait la saine et bonne méthode pour remettre la table sur ses pieds?

Merci !

Je peux ajouter pour cerner le diagnostique, que j’ai un message CRON tous les 1/4d’h comme suis :

Merci !